Table 1.

Anthropometric and metabolic data in 24 MUT/MUT subjects and 25 MUT/N subjects involved in experiment 2. Data are expressed as mean (s.d.), except for HOMA–IR, HOMA-β, and IGI, which are expressed as median (interquartile range).

MUT/MUT MUT/N P
Age (years) 39.25 (11.73) 40.08 (10.87) 0.798
Sex (males/females) 12/12 12/13 1.000
Height (cm) 128.21 (9.42) 160.66 (9.27) <0.001
Weight (kg) 37.2 (5.95) 59.35 (10.26) <0.001
BMI (kg/m2) 22.9 (4.68) 22.88 (2.79) 0.983
Waist (cm) 76.5 (9.99) 80.46 (7.72) 0.139
Hip (cm) 81.94 (8.01) 91.95 (7.9) <0.001
W:H ratio 0.93 (0.09) 0.88 (0.09) 0.033
HOMA–IR 0.55 (0.49) 0.96 (0.57) 0.004
QUICKI 0.43 (0.04) 0.39 (0.04) 0.005
OGIS2 444.3 (49.6) 413.18 (59.74) 0.054
OGIS3 453.6 (62.14) 430.14 (72.2) 0.230
HOMA-β 28.1 (14.52) 52.24 (42.4) 0.005
IGI 0.4 (0.36) 0.99 (0.98) 0.001
AUC I (μU/ml):G  (mg/dl) 0.22 (0.08) 0.36 (0.17) 0.001
